ArcSiteArcSite

Mobile-first CAD for construction estimating, takeoffs, and proposals.

Strengths

  • +Significantly reduces time spent on estimates and proposals in the field.
  • +Enhances accuracy of measurements, material calculations, and pricing.
  • +Improves team communication and consistency across projects.
  • +Allows for professional-level drawings without extensive CAD expertise.
  • +Supports capturing down payments directly on-site.

Weaknesses

  • -Requires adoption of a new mobile-first workflow for traditional users.
  • -Specific pricing details are not publicly listed, requiring a demo or contact.

Key features

Mobile CAD drawing with precision toolsMaterial takeoff and cost estimation linked to drawingsCustomizable product and pricing catalogsBranded proposal generation and digital signature captureCloud-enabled collaboration and sharing of drawingsExtensive library of pre-made and custom CAD shapes
Starts at $14.99/mo

ServiceTradeServiceTrade

Empower commercial service contractors with an end-to-end field service management platform.

Strengths

  • +Reduces technician windshield time through optimized routing.
  • +Accelerates billing cycles and improves cash flow.
  • +Enhances customer loyalty with transparent, proactive communication.
  • +Provides comprehensive asset history and inspection workflows for compliance.
  • +Unifies field and office teams for improved decision-making.

Weaknesses

  • -Primarily focused on commercial service contractors, potentially less suitable for other service types.
  • -Specific pricing details are not publicly available, requiring direct contact for quotes.

Key features

Intelligent Scheduling and DispatchingTechnician Mobile App with Asset History and ChecklistsIntegrated Commercial Services CRMCustomer Self-Service PortalDigital Proposals and Electronic SignaturesReal-time Management Visibility and Business Reporting
Starts at Custom
